The Psychology of Flower Colors

Colors go beyond mere aesthetics; they evoke powerful emotions and set the tone in any setting. Here’s an overview of what different preserved flower colors symbolize and how you can harness their meaning.

Red

  • Symbolism: Passion, love, and romance
  • Perfect for: Romantic gifts, anniversaries, or Valentine's Day

Preserved Flower Care by Color

To keep your preserved flowers vibrant:

  • Deep colors (Red, Black) may need to be shielded from direct sunlight to maintain intensity.
  • Soft colors (White, Pastels) brighten well under natural but indirect light.

Place flowers in prominent, well-ventilated areas like living rooms, dining rooms, or entryways for maximum impact.
